summ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orTim Lunn <tim@feathertop.org>2016-01-15 11:03:40 +1100
committerVictor Toso <me@victortoso.com>2016-01-15 10:42:19 +0100
commit586dd093096422522e7872e3a37c7597cd264e0a (patch)
tree0319d70f91c4b48017d172a98c2e2729fdd8edfd
parent5a0b679fc521b4c389d0c46bf4fa3bb674b77f3d (diff)
core: plug leak of filename
https://bugzilla.gnome.org/show_bug.cgi?id=760648
-rw-r--r--src/grl-registry.c1
1 files changed, 1 insertions, 0 deletions
diff --git a/src/grl-registry.c b/src/grl-registry.c
index 0622ef0..de04000 100644
--- a/src/grl-registry.c
+++ b/src/grl-registry.c
@@ -1264,6 +1264,7 @@ grl_registry_load_plugin_directory (GrlRegistry *registry,
while ((entry = g_dir_read_name (dir)) != NULL) {
filename = g_build_filename (path, entry, NULL);
if (g_strrstr (filename, "." G_MODULE_SUFFIX) == NULL) {
+ g_free (filename);
continue;
}